Heads up, night crew: the Marlowe Systems intern cohort lands Monday morning, but a few of them are doing early setup shifts, so you might see unfamiliar faces before 06:00. They should all be escorted by Priya from Talent Ops — if they're alone, walk them back to the lobby. To let escorted groups through the side entrance, use the pass code below.

door code, yagap-bahof: bdg-O-05

## Design Excerpt: Proctor Assignment Queue

The Vigilum proctoring queue assigns live proctors to exam sessions via a priority heap keyed on wait time and integrity-flag severity. All queue entries are encrypted at rest, and proctor identities are pseudonymized until assignment completes to limit insider targeting. A security concern we want reviewed: starvation of low-severity sessions could be exploited by flooding high-severity flags, so we enforce aging and per-tenant rate caps. The initial tuning constants are defined below.

tuning table, yajog-yahof:
BUDGETS = {
    "lamvan": 303,
    "wenox": 460,
    "fenvan": 525,
}

MEMO — Board of Stellwick Retail Group

The Amberline loyalty programme will be overhauled in two phases: points consolidation first, tier restructure second. Redemption liability falls under the new rules; legal has cleared the change. Member communications begin next month. The overhaul supports a strategic move not yet disclosed, which is set out in the confidential note below.

board note of kageg-bahof: The renewal with Holwynax Holdings closes at $2 million a year, 5 percent below the last contract. Project Ulaath slips by two quarters because of the supplier delay.